WebThe Act 9 Geo. 1. c. 22, commonly known as the Black Act, or the Waltham Black Act, and sometimes called the Black Act 1722, the Black Act 1723, the Waltham Black Act 1722, the Criminal Law Act 1722, or the Criminal Law Act 1723, was an Act of the Parliament of Great Britain.It was passed in 1723 in response to a series of raids by two groups of … Web(i) Direct or primary liability of the employer. (ii) Vicarious liability: until 1948 the doctrine of “common employment” meant that, where the injured person and the tortfeasor were employees of the same employer, that employer was not vicariously liable. That was abolished by the Law Reform (Personal Injuries) Act 1948 s. 1.
